E prefixed to a four- or five-digit numbering system in … Web2 Feb 2024 · The weld strength formula for single butt joint welding is: P = t l \sigma_\mathrm {t} P = tlσt. where l is the length of the weld joint. Similarly, the strength of double butt joint welding is: P = (t_1 + t_2) l \sigma_\mathrm {t} P = (t1 + t2)lσt.
